0

我正在开发一款游戏,我想根据加速度计移动 UIImageView。当我从左到右或从右到左旋转 iPhone 设备时,UIImageView 必须以特定角度旋转。它也在移动,但是当我因为那个声音播放背景声音时会出现问题,即使我的 iPhone 空闲,它也会发送一些加速点。所以我的 UIImageView 也在移动。它不应该发生。当我降低 iphone 音量时,它工作得很好。我必须为此做些什么。

而且,如果有人知道如何仅在 iphone 从左到右或从右到左移动时获得加速点。它不应该检测到 iphone 何时是 xz 或 yz 平面。

如果有人知道解决方案,请回复。

4

1 回答 1

2

您是否对加速度计的输入进行了过滤?我希望加速度计拾取的扬声器发出的噪音在幅度和频率上与游戏控制有很大不同。

Apple 加速度计图形示例代码中有一个简单的低通滤波器。

于 2009-04-10T08:14:18.057 回答